The Box Houston Featured Video

….The Dirty Rotten Scoundrels.

Better known as D.R.S.  In November of 1993 they had the #1 song in the country with an ode to the dead homiez in “Gangsta Lean”.

They followed it up with “Skoundrels Get Lonely” which failed to sustain the momentum of “Gangsta Lean”.

With that in mind let’s pour out a little for the homiez D.R.S. and take a trip down memory lane.

More From TheBoxHouston